Artist | Atmosphere |
Album | When Life Gives You Lemons, You Paint That Shit Gold |
Release Date | 2008-04-22 |
Description | “Me” is an autobiographical song of sorts from Slug, talking about his childhood and the man he’s become now; flaws and all. |
